Doxapram hydrochloride is a CNS respiratory stimulant drug (H302 classification). It has no place in cosmetic products under EU Regulation 1223/2009 and is not listed in any cosmetic regulation annex. Its pharmaceutical status as a respiratory stimulant precludes any cosmetic application.

Known concerns

  • Acute oral toxicity (H302)
  • CNS and respiratory stimulation effects
  • Prohibited pharmaceutical in cosmetics
